Radioiodinated derivatives for steroid radioimmunoassay. Application to the radioimmunoassay of cortisol

Gamma-emitting steroid tracers for use in the radioimmunoassay of steroids have a number of advantages over the more common tritiated tracers. The steroid derivatives aldosterone-3-(p-hydroxybenzoyl) hydrazone, aldosterone-3-(p-hydroxyphenylpropionyl)hydrazone, deoxycorticosterone-3-(p-hydroxyphenylpropionyl)hydrazone, and cortisol-3-(p-hydroxyphenylpropionyl)hydrazone were synthesized by a one-step procedure and iodinated ((/sup 125/I)). To illustrate the usefulness of these derivatives, we describe the details of a cortisol radioimmunoassay. The use of the radioiodinated tracer appeared to increase the specificity of the antigen-antibody reaction when compared with (/sup 3/H)cortisol. The methodology involved in the preparation of the steroid derivatives described above can be extended to other 3-oxo-4-ene-containing steroids, with the advantages of economy, simplicity, and versatility.
